Output 89b6ef21dd58d59ea20ade9838bbc8df6b636fc66544aec8e6304f0a2422fd85:1

value
67568
script pubkey
OP_0 OP_PUSHBYTES_20 27648d05c6fc9ddbd79f3975ce5563b5cf762e96
address
bc1qyajg6pwxljwah4ul896uu4trkh8hvt5k36ttx9
transaction
89b6ef21dd58d59ea20ade9838bbc8df6b636fc66544aec8e6304f0a2422fd85
confirmations
2342
spent
true